Golf Films is a franchise of films produced by Golf Channel, which originated in 1995 as the first U.S. single-sport cable network, co-founded by Arnold Palmer.. The biographical features in the Golf Films library cover a wide range of key figures and events that have changed the game in unique ways, in particular over the last century.

The Squeeze is a 2015 feature film starring Jeremy Sumpter as Augie, a young golfer who just won the local tournament by 15 strokes and tied and broke the public course record during the tournament, and is seduced by a gambler to play golf for bet money. Everything goes well until he goes to Las Vegas and has his life and his family on the line ...
Uneven Fairways: The Story of the Negro Leagues of Golf is a 2009 documentary film of the history of African-American golfers.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] The documentary premiered on the Golf Channel on February 11, 2009 [ 1 ] [ 2 ] and is based on the books Uneven Fairways by Pete McDaniel, and Forbidden Fairways , by Dr. Calvin Sinnette.
